Overview of On Tyranny

In this urgent 126-page bestseller, historian Timothy Snyder offers twenty lessons to defend democracy against authoritarianism. Topping charts after Trump's inauguration, this "how-to guide for resisting tyranny" became required reading in classrooms nationwide - a stark warning The Washington Post called "clarifying and unnerving."

Democracy's Fragile Heartbeat

play
00:00
00:00

History doesn't repeat, but it rhymes with alarming precision. Democracy isn't our birthright - it's a delicate achievement that can unravel with terrifying speed. When Yale historian Timothy Snyder published "On Tyranny" in 2017, he wasn't offering abstract theory but practical wisdom distilled from studying how European democracies collapsed into fascism and communism. The slim volume became a cultural phenomenon precisely because it tapped into our collective anxiety - that the guardrails protecting our freedoms are more vulnerable than we imagined. The most chilling insight? Democracy rarely dies through dramatic coups. Instead, it erodes through a series of seemingly small compromises until the point of no return has silently passed. The parties that successfully dismantled democracies weren't omnipotent from the start - they exploited historic moments to make political life impossible for their opponents. They followed remarkably similar playbooks: win elections (often with minorities of the vote), create constant crises to justify emergency powers, use those powers to silence opposition, and finally consolidate one-party rule. Many voters never realized they were casting their final meaningful ballot.
